APAC Salary Benchmark 2026

What global teams pay to hire engineers remotely from Asia. 208 benchmarks across 31 roles and 9 markets, quoted as the hourly rate an international employer actually pays, with the local employed salary alongside it.

USD per hour, midpoint of the senior band, as quoted for an international employer. Rates are what a remote engagement costs; the employed-salary figures further down are a different measurement and the two are never converted into one another.

Finding 01

Two Ways to Hire, Two Different Numbers

A global team can engage an engineer in Asia remotely on an hourly rate, or employ them locally on a salary. Both are priced below, and they are not the same measurement. An hourly rate carries utilisation, benefits, bench time and engagement risk that a salary does not.

The common mistake is multiplying an hourly rate by 2,080 and calling the result an annual cost. Do that to a $70 Vietnam rate and you get $145,000, which is nowhere near what employing that engineer costs. This report never converts one into the other, and neither should a budget.

If you employ rather than contract, the statutory employer add-on runs from 0.61% in Thailand to 20.26% in China. Most Asian schemes are capped, so the percentage falls as pay rises: Vietnam charges 23.5% of a mid-level wage and 14.2% of a senior one.

Market Roles Remote rate (USD/hr) vs US rate Employed salary Employer burden Employed total What drives the burden
Philippines 29 $48 −65% $24,500 +13.5% $27,800 Low ceilings; the statutory 13th month is the larger half
Vietnam 27 $51 −62% $31,300 +14.2% $35,700 Capped contributions, so the rate falls from 23.5% at mid pay
Indonesia 28 $53 −61% $20,600 +14.6% $23,600 BPJS near 9% plus the statutory THR at 8.33%
Thailand 21 $54 −60% $43,500 +0.61% $43,800 Social security is capped at THB 15,000 of wages
Malaysia 22 $55 −59% $39,600 +13.6% $45,000 EPF 12% plus SOCSO and EIS on a capped wage
Taiwan 11 $68 −50% $52,500 +13.74% $59,700 Labour and health insurance plus a 6% pension contribution
Singapore 27 $80 −41% $122,300 +17% $143,000 CPF 17% for citizens and PRs, nil for Employment Pass holders
China 20 $80 −41% $95,000 +20.26% $114,200 The heaviest in the region even after the caps bite
Hong Kong 23 $103 −24% $137,500 +1.88% $140,100 MPF is capped at HKD 1,500 a month

Median across every role we benchmark in that market, so each figure reflects the mix of roles rather than one job title. The remote rate is what an international employer pays per hour. The employed columns are a separate model: local salary plus statutory contributions, before recruitment, equipment and any entity or employer-of-record fee.

The Comparison You Are Making

What the Same Seniority Costs Outside Asia

An Asian rate only means something against the rate it replaces. These are senior contract rates on the same basis as the columns above: what a buyer pays per hour, not what an employee earns.

The gap is widest in Southeast Asia and narrowest in Hong Kong and Singapore, which are developed markets competing for the same engineers as London and New York rather than undercutting them.

United States

$110–$160/hr

Senior contract bill rate through an agency or staffing firm

United Kingdom

$100–$160/hr

£600 to £1,000 a day for a senior contractor, at eight hours

Western Europe

$100–$180/hr

Germany, the Netherlands and the Nordics sit in a similar band

Finding 02

The Market Matters More than the Role

Across the whole dataset the highest-rated role commands roughly 2.7x the lowest at the same seniority. But the same single role swings up to 3.2x between its cheapest and dearest Asian market.

Which is to say: where you hire moves the number more than what you hire. A regional average is the wrong unit for a budget. Benchmark the role in the specific market, and decide the engagement model before you compare anything.

Finding 03

What Each Step of Seniority Costs

Median remote rate at each band across all 208 benchmarks, expressed as a multiple of junior. The curve is steeper than most budget models assume, and the step from mid to senior is the expensive one.

It is usually still the right step to take. A senior engineer working async against a distant time zone needs less supervision, which is the scarce resource on a global team rather than the hourly rate.

junior (208 benchmarks) $29/hr · 1.00x
Mid-level (208 benchmarks) $43/hr · 1.48x
senior (208 benchmarks) $60/hr · 2.09x
lead (208 benchmarks) $83/hr · 2.87x

Median remote rate across every role and market. Junior is nought to two years, mid three to five, senior six or more, lead is a role with reporting or architecture ownership.

Method

Where the numbers come from. Second Talent's own rate cards, one per role and market, maintained from placement and offer data. This report reads all 208 of them so the benchmark and the individual rate card pages state the same numbers rather than drifting apart.

Remote rates. The USD hourly figure each rate card lists for an international employer. Quoted as an hourly range and never annualised: multiplying a contract rate by a full-time year implies a utilisation, a benefits load and a bench cost the number does not contain.

Employed salaries. The local monthly band from the same rate card. Local salaries converted at spot rates on 20 August 2026, annualised at twelve months and rounded to the nearest $500. Currency moves alone will shift these between editions.

Global reference rates. Senior contract rates outside Asia, collected from published 2026 contractor and staff-augmentation rate surveys rather than derived from our own data. They are stated as ranges because agency, direct and platform rates differ materially for the same engineer.

Employer burden. Statutory employer contributions at senior salary level, taken from our country payroll guides, each of which is checked against the statutory arithmetic before publication. Most Asian schemes are capped, so we use the senior-level rate rather than the headline percentage.

What is excluded. Bonus, equity, recruitment fees, equipment, entity or employer-of-record cost and discretionary benefits. These apply across every market and would not reorder the tables.

Limits. These are market ranges, not a census, and the spread inside a single market is wider than the gap between some of the markets listed. Cambodia and India are markets we place into but do not yet have verified statutory figures for, so they are held out rather than estimated.
